Do not open attachments or click on links if you do not recognize the sender. ________________________________ Is anyone having issues with patients who have persistent hypotension after fluids defined as SBP < 90, but they still have a MAP of > or equal to 65 and no vasopressors being ordered? My facility's vasopressor orders read to initiate when the MAP is < 65. We have had two patients who did not meet that criteria until after the 6 hour window was up for vasopressors. Are other facility's changing their practice to start pressors for SBP < 90? Thanks.
